Fabio Capello: 'Russia team too insular'

Fabio Capello advises some of his Russian team to seek moves away from Russia's domestic league in a bid to broaden their horizons.

Russia coach Fabio Capello has encouraged some of his players to seek moves away from the country's domestic league in order to further their development.

None of Capello's 23-man squad plies their trade outside of Russia at club level.

With the nation struggling in their World Cup campaign thus far, the former England boss believes that it would be beneficial for his playing staff to leave their comfort zone to aid success in future tournaments.

"I think that playing abroad helps everyone mature and improve," he told FIFA.com.

"Russia hadn't participated in a World Cup for 12 years and we have to remember that. If you always play in the same championship it is very difficult to improve."

The Russians must beat Algeria in their final Group H encounter this evening to stand any chance of reaching the last 16, having drawn with South Korea and lost to Belgium.
